What Can We Learn from the French Health Care System?
The French Health Care System (FHCS) has been lauded as one of the most efficient and generous healthcare systems in the world. According to the World Health Organization, it ranks first among 191 countries, providing exemplary care and universal coverage. As a practitioner in the field of special education, there are valuable lessons to be learned from the FHCS that can enhance your practice and benefit your students.### Key Features of the FHCSThe FHCS is characterized by its blend of public and private sectors, universal coverage, and a strong commitment to equity and patient choice. Here are some key features:- **Universal Coverage**: All residents contribute according to their means and receive services according to their needs.- **Equity**: The system ensures equitable geographical coverage and provides protective mechanisms so that cost-sharing does not prevent people from receiving necessary care.- **Patient Choice**: Patients have the freedom to choose their healthcare providers without needing pre-authorizations for procedures.### Implementing Lessons from FHCS in Special Education#### 1. **Universal Access to Services**The FHCS's model of universal coverage can be applied to ensure that all students, regardless of their socio-economic status, have access to necessary educational and therapeutic services. This can be achieved by advocating for policies that provide funding and resources for all students.#### 2. **Equitable Distribution of Resources**Just as the FHCS ensures equitable geographical coverage, special education programs should strive to provide equal access to resources and services across different regions. This can involve:- Establishing satellite therapy centers in underserved areas.- Utilizing teletherapy to reach students in remote locations.#### 3. **Patient (Student) Choice**Empowering students and their families with choices in their educational and therapeutic plans can lead to better outcomes. This can include:- Offering a variety of therapy options (e.g., in-person, online, hybrid).- Allowing families to choose their preferred therapists or special education teachers.### Encouraging Further ResearchThe FHCS is continuously evolving to meet new challenges and improve efficiency.
